Do you want to wirelessly display contents from your smartphone or tablet to a projector? Miracast technology is your answer. What is Miracast? It’s a wireless display standard developed by the Wi-Fi Alliance that lets you beam the screen of your mobile device to a Miracast-enabled displays like projectors.

Fortunately, many modern projectors support Miracast technology. But to know which projectors support Miracast, read on.

How to Screen Mirror iPhone on Projectors: A Comprehensive Guide

Screen mirroring is a great way to share content from your iPhone with a larger audience. Whether its for a business presentation or a movie night with friends and family, the ability to cast your iPhone screen on a projector can make a big difference. In this article, we will be discussing how to screen mirror iPhone on projectors in a step-by-step guide.

Step 1: Check the Compatibility of Your Projector

Before jumping into the process, its important to check the compatibility of your projector with the iPhone. For this, you can check the projectors user manual or search the web for the make and model of your projector to see if it is compatible with iPhones. Its also important to ensure that your iPhone is running on iOS 11 or later.

Step 2: Connect Your iPhone to the Projector

The next step is to connect your iPhone to the projector. There are different ways to do this, depending on the type of projector you have. Some projectors have built-in wireless connectivity, while others may require a wired connection. If your projector has a wireless connection option, you can use AirPlay to connect your iPhone to the projector. To do this, simply swipe up from the bottom of your iPhone screen and tap on the AirPlay icon. Then, select your projector from the list of available devices.

If your projector does not have a wireless connection option, you can use a Lightning to HDMI adapter to connect your iPhone to the projector. Simply plug the adapter into your iPhones Lightning port and connect the HDMI cable to the adapter and the projector.

Step 3: Mirror Your iPhone Screen

Once your iPhone is connected to the projector, you can start screen mirroring. To do this, simply swipe up from the bottom of your iPhone screen and tap on the Screen Mirroring icon. Then, select your projector from the list of available devices. Your iPhone screen should now be mirrored on the projector.

Step 4: Adjust the Settings

Depending on the content you are sharing, you may need to adjust the settings on your iPhone or projector to optimize the display. For example, you may need to adjust the resolution, aspect ratio, or brightness of the projector. You can also adjust the orientation of your iPhone screen to match the orientation of the projector.

Conclusion

Screen mirroring your iPhone to a projector can be a great way to share content with a larger audience. By following these simple steps, you can easily set up screen mirroring on your iPhone and projector. Remember to check the compatibility of your devices, connect your iPhone to the projector, mirror your screen, and adjust the settings as needed. With these tips in mind, you can enjoy a seamless screen mirroring experience.
